Abstract
Nonmetallic inclusions in magnetic alloys of the Fe – Co – Ni – Cu – Al – Ti system with additions of niobium and hafnium used in the production of single-crystal permanent magnets are studied. The kinds of inclusions in magnetic alloys are determined with the help of rapid analysis of the chemical composition, optical and electron microscopy, quantitative microscopic x-ray spectrum analysis, and electron back-scatter diffraction. The phase compositions are computed with the help of the Thermo-Calc software.
